The Warrior Alpha LX Pro hockey stick is designed for powerful, accurate shots, featuring the Sabre Taper II design for a low kick point and stable shaft. This enables effective slap shots and quick wrist shots. It's made with a lightweight, durable construction using high-grade carbon composites, and the FuelCore Ultra blade provides a good balance of durability and puck control.

The Alpha LX Pro uses the saber taper, a fixture of Warrior's low kickpoint sticks. Saber taper is a longer, more aggressive taper from the hosel down to the blade versus your traditional stick, which starts to taper pretty low. The Warrior taper starts a bit higher to give more movement into that low kickpoint stick. Also, Warrior has used minimus carbon construction for a very long time and their sticks are super light and strong.
